The Bently Nevada 990-08-XX-01-05, also cataloged as the 990 Vibration Transmitter, operates as a dedicated hardware component for casing-to-shaft vibration signal conditioning within machine protection platforms.

Transducer Dynamics & Signal Conditioning

The 990 series transmitter employs eddy-current probe scaling to convert proximity signals into a proportional output. Proper operation relies on gap voltage validation against -10 VDC targets to maintain functionality within the linear range of the transducer. The device architecture incorporates cross-talk suppression, allowing multiple transmitters to operate in high-density proximity arrays without interference. Monitoring of rotor dynamics requires a target surface with a minimum 9.5 mm diameter to ensure signal accuracy.

Field Installation Guidelines

  • Power Supply: Ensure a stable DC source between 12 VDC and 35 VDC is connected to the transmitter terminals.
  • Signal Grounding: Terminate the coaxial cable shield at the designated ground reference to maintain signal integrity and satisfy EMI protection requirements.
  • Environmental Protection: While rated for Zone 2 or Div 2 hazardous areas, ensure the transmitter is housed in an enclosure suitable for the specific site environmental exposure levels.
  • Target Alignment: Verify that the monitored shaft or target surface is centered relative to the probe to avoid non-linear measurement effects.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• What is the consequence of a target surface diameter less than 9.5 mm?

    A surface smaller than 9.5 mm causes signal non-linearity and measurement errors, as the eddy-current field will extend beyond the target edges, resulting in inaccurate vibration readings.

  • Does this transmitter support hot-swapping during operation?

    The device does not support hot-swapping; power must be disconnected from the transmitter loop to avoid potential current surges or spurious alarm trips in the monitoring system.

  • What is the impact of exceeding 35 VDC at the input terminal?

    Operating above the maximum 35 VDC limit will damage internal voltage regulation circuitry and may result in permanent failure of the transmitter.

  • Can the frequency response be adjusted beyond 6,000 Hz?

    The 6,000 Hz limit is a factory-defined characteristic of the internal signal conditioning filters; it cannot be modified by the user in the field.

  • How does the storage temperature range affect deployment?

    The -52 deg C to +100 deg C storage range ensures component viability for long-term storage in extreme climates, provided the unit is kept in its original sealed packaging.

  • Are shielding requirements strictly dependent on the cable length?

    Shielding is required regardless of cable length to maintain RFI/EMI immunity, particularly in environments with high-frequency industrial noise or radio interference.

  • Why is the -10 VDC gap voltage target necessary for this transmitter?

    It ensures the probe is centered within its linear displacement range; deviations from this target shift the measurement baseline and can lead to signal clipping.

  • Is the 28 V power supply rating a specific constraint?

    The 28 V rating denotes the power supply limit for hazardous area installations (Zone 2/Div 2) to ensure compliance with intrinsic safety or non-incendive design constraints.
